The role

The Director, Philanthropic Giving–Northeast will build and lead the major-gift effort across the Northeast, with a focus on New York City, to support the USOPC's fundraising goals for the 2028 Olympic and Paralympic Games and beyond.

What you'll do

  • Build and lead the major-gift effort across the Northeast
  • Identify, cultivate, and develop prospects capable of $250,000+ gifts
  • Generate momentum in a market with substantial room to grow
  • Work independently to open doors and close gifts
  • Collaborate with colleagues and senior leaders
  • Translate complex organizational funding needs into compelling gift proposals

What it takes

  • 8+ years of successful fundraising experience
  • Experience working in a development officer role in the Northeast
  • Appreciation for the Olympic & Paralympic Movements
  • Superior written and verbal communication skills
  • Exceptional attention to detail
  • Proven ability to build relationships to foster charitable gifts
